We investigate the simplest quintessence dissipative dark matter attractor cosmology characterized by a constant quintessence baryotropic index and a power--law expansion. We show a class of accelerated coincidence--solving attractor solutions converging to this asymptotic behavior. Despite its simplicity, such a ``superattractor´´ regime provides a model of the recent universe that also exhibits an excellent fit to supernovae luminosity observations and no age conflict. Our best fit gives $alpha=1.71pm 0.29$ for the power-law exponent. We calculate for this regime the evolution of density and entropy perturbations.
